Moosehead Marine Museum
Museum · Greenville, Maine
A Greenville museum built around the historic steamship Katahdin, added to the National Register of Historic Places in 1979.
History
The museum's own history page states, "In 1977, they founded the nonprofit Moosehead Marine Museum, acquiring the Katahdin as its star exhibit," and "In 1979 the 'Kate' was added to the National Register of Historic Places." Per the museum's own "Museum" page, it "houses a wide array of nautical treasures" and operates seasonally, with 2026 hours running June 16 through October 11, Tuesday through Saturday.
